                           Approval of Business Rescue Plan                        

    Further to the announcement released by the Company on 1 December 2015, IFL
    announces that the Business Rescue Plan ("Plan") proposed by the Business
    Rescue Practitioner ("BRP") (available on the Company's website), has been
    approved by creditors. The BRP will now seek to negotiate and execute the
    relevant sale agreements with Samancor Chrome Limited ("Samancor") as quickly
    as possible, but by no later than 15 February 2016, otherwise the BRP will need
    to revert to International Ferro Metals (SA) (Pty) Limited's ("IFMSA") major
    creditors, Bank of China and the Company's subsidiary International Ferro
    Metals SA Holdings (Pty) Limited.

    The Company reiterates that it currently is not possible to assess with any
    certainty what potential return may be received by the Company because of
    uncertainties related to future costs and cash flows to fund the business
    rescue proceedings. The Plan does provide an illustration and estimate of the
    potential distribution to creditors of IFMSA in terms of the Plan. The Plan
    assumes that the proceeds derived by IFMSA from the proposed transaction will
    be an amount of ZAR720 million. However, it is no more than an example and is
    not binding on the BRP. The illustration is subject to change depending on the
    circumstances at the time the distribution is to be made.

    About International Ferro Metals:

    International Ferro Metals produces ferrochrome, the essential ingredient in
    stainless steel, from its integrated chromite mine and ferrochrome processing
    operations in South Africa.  International Ferro Metals is listed on the London
    Stock Exchange under the symbol IFL.
